Analysis

The most recent figure for emissions from livestock — emissions in Belarus is 348.13 kt, measured in 2050. That is the lowest value across all 34 years on record.

Over the whole period, emissions from livestock — emissions in Belarus peaked at 558.38 kt in 1992 and was at its lowest, 348.13 kt, in 2050.

Belarus ranks 60th of 195 countries on this measure, in the middle of the range.

The long-run direction has been consistently falling across the 34 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
